Warranty Procedures
Any product that shows signs of failure shall be returned to BioEnable for inspection to
determine whether it is a repair or replacement item. If expedited service is needed,
the additional expense will be billed.
The policy is to repair or replace a defective item as quickly as possible. BioEnable is not
responsible for any "down time" related costs, such as, but not limited to, expedited
shipping charges. BioEnable do not cover labor charges regarding removal or reinstallation nor do they cover additional items needed during reinstallation such as fixtures etc... at client’s premises.
BioEnable customers/authorized dealers shall keep invoice as proof of purchase, warranty claims may be refused at the BioEnable if a copy of the invoice cannot be
presented if asked by BioEnable at any time.
Any other unconventional accessories installed with the product, not approved by the
BioEnable will usually and unequivocally void your warranty.

Authorized dealer are required to sell their stocks within 2 months of purchasing from BioEnable. The maximum warranty offered is 14 months from the date of purchase by BioEnable authorized dealer.
In case the product come for repair and service under warranty which was manufactured
15 months back, service department in no case can process it in under warranty scheme
irrespective of the date of purchase by the customer.
If the data of manufacturing is say approx. 12 months to 14 months old, then service
department will ask for proof from the customer about the date of Purchase in the form of
invoice from BioEnable or our authorized reseller. Please note that this is Invoice
available with the end-user and not the BioEnable invoice made to authorized dealer. Even if dealer
send a unit for processing under warranty, is suppose to present the invoice showing
date of sale instead of BioEnable invoice given to him. If this date of purchase by the
customer is not satisfactorily proven to the Service department, then service department
will make decisions based on approx. calculations and customer claims.
If the date of manufacturing on the product is less then 12 months then service
department will not ask for anything from customer or reseller.
